状态栏高度多少
作者:路由通
|
329人看过
发布时间:2026-03-12 04:23:40
标签:
状态栏高度作为用户界面设计的关键尺寸,直接影响视觉体验与交互效率。本文系统梳理安卓、苹果iOS、鸿蒙等主流系统状态栏的标准与历史演变,深入剖析全面屏、折叠屏等新型设备带来的设计挑战,并结合谷歌、苹果官方设计规范,提供适配不同分辨率与设备类型的实用设计指南。文章涵盖从基础定义到高级适配策略的完整知识体系,旨在为设计师与开发者提供权威参考。
当我们每天点亮手机或使用电脑时,屏幕顶部那条显示着时间、电量、网络信号等信息的细长区域,就是状态栏。这个看似不起眼的界面元素,其高度尺寸的精确设定,却是整个用户界面设计的基础与起点。一个恰到好处的状态栏高度,不仅能确保关键信息的清晰可读,更能与应用程序界面无缝融合,为用户带来沉浸、舒适且高效的交互体验。那么,状态栏高度究竟是多少?这个问题的答案并非一成不变,它随着操作系统演进、设备形态革新以及设计理念的变化而不断发展。本文将为您深入剖析状态栏高度的方方面面,从标准规范到实践适配,提供一份全面而深入的指南。
状态栏的定义与核心功能 状态栏,通常指位于设备屏幕最顶部的系统级界面区域。它的核心功能是持续、非侵入性地向用户展示设备及系统的关键状态信息。这些信息通常包括但不限于:当前时间、蜂窝网络信号强度、无线网络连接状态、电池电量与充电状态、系统通知图标、以及在某些系统下的快捷设置入口。状态栏的设计需要遵循“常驻可见但又不喧宾夺主”的原则,它必须足够清晰以便用户随时扫视获取信息,同时又不能占用过多的屏幕空间而影响主应用程序内容的展示。因此,其高度的精确控制,成为平衡信息密度与屏幕利用率的关键。 苹果iOS系统的状态栏高度演进 苹果公司的iOS系统在状态栏设计上一直保持着高度的规范性和一致性。在早期搭载非全面屏的iPhone上,例如iPhone 8系列,状态栏高度固定为20点(Points)。这里的“点”是iOS开发中使用的与分辨率无关的逻辑单位。随着iPhone X引入全面屏和“刘海”设计,状态栏区域发生了根本性变化。由于需要为传感器和摄像头模组预留空间,状态栏的高度增加了。在iPhone X及后续的全面屏机型(包括iPhone XS系列、iPhone 11系列、iPhone 12系列、iPhone 13系列、iPhone 14系列等)上,状态栏的安全区域高度通常为44点。这44点的高度包含了“刘海”两侧耳朵区域显示的内容。开发者需要特别关注苹果官方提供的“安全区域”布局指南,确保内容不被刘海或圆角遮挡。 安卓系统状态栏高度的多样性 与iOS的高度统一不同,安卓生态因其开放性和设备碎片化,状态栏高度呈现出显著的多样性。谷歌在其官方设计语言“材料设计”中提供了指导原则,但并未强制规定一个绝对的像素值。通常,在标准的安卓设备上,状态栏高度约为24dp(密度无关像素)至28dp之间。例如,在谷歌Pixel系列原生安卓设备上,这一数值有明确的规范。然而,众多其他设备制造商,如三星、小米、华为、欧珀、维沃等,都会根据自家设备的屏幕比例、圆角曲率以及品牌UI的视觉风格,对状态栏高度进行微调。因此,对于安卓开发者而言,必须通过编程方式动态获取状态栏的高度值,而非使用硬编码的固定数值,这是实现跨设备适配的基础。 华为鸿蒙系统的状态栏设计 华为自主研发的鸿蒙操作系统,在其设计规范中同样对状态栏区域有明确界定。鸿蒙系统强调全场景体验,其状态栏设计需要适配手机、平板、智慧屏等多种设备。以鸿蒙手机为例,其状态栏高度也遵循了全面屏时代的适配逻辑,通常会区分标准状态栏和包含“挖孔”或“刘海”的安全区域高度。开发者需参考鸿蒙官方提供的资源定义,例如通过“系统能力”接口获取状态栏的具体尺寸,以确保应用界面在不同鸿蒙设备上都能正确布局,避免内容与摄像头挖孔或状态栏信息重叠。 平板电脑与折叠屏设备的特殊考量 当设备屏幕尺寸增大,如平板电脑,状态栏的设计逻辑有时会发生变化。部分平板系统可能会略微增加状态栏高度,以容纳更多的系统状态图标或便于触控。更为复杂的场景出现在折叠屏设备上。以三星Galaxy Z Fold系列或华为Mate X系列为例,设备有内屏和外屏两种状态,屏幕展开和折叠时,状态栏的高度、位置甚至内容都可能需要动态调整。例如,在外屏上,状态栏高度可能与普通手机一致;而在展开后的大内屏上,系统可能会采用更窄的状态栏以最大化显示区域,或者将状态栏与任务栏进行融合设计。这要求应用具备响应式布局能力,能根据当前可用的屏幕空间和安全区域实时调整界面。 桌面操作系统中的状态栏概念 在桌面操作系统领域,如微软的视窗系统或苹果的麦金塔操作系统,类似的概念通常被称为“菜单栏”或“任务栏”的一部分。虽然名称和形态与移动设备的状态栏不同,但其功能本质相似:提供一个常驻区域来显示系统状态、时间、通知和快速访问入口。以视窗系统为例,其任务栏的默认高度是可以由用户自定义调整的,这体现了桌面系统更强调用户自定义的特性。然而,在应用开发中,特别是开发全屏应用时,开发者仍需考虑如何避免应用窗口内容与系统任务栏重叠的问题,这涉及到获取屏幕工作区尺寸的应用程序编程接口调用。 状态栏高度与屏幕分辨率、像素密度的关系 理解状态栏高度,绝不能脱离屏幕分辨率和像素密度。设计师在绘图软件中设定的高度值(如iOS的“点”或安卓的“dp”),都是与设备无关的逻辑单位。这些逻辑单位会在不同物理屏幕上,根据其像素密度转换为实际的物理像素。例如,一个44点高的iOS状态栏,在视网膜显示屏上可能会对应88个物理像素的高度。因此,谈论状态栏高度时,必须明确其单位是逻辑单位还是物理像素,并理解目标设备的屏幕参数,才能进行精准的视觉还原和开发实现。 全面屏与异形屏带来的适配挑战 “全面屏”的普及和“刘海屏”、“挖孔屏”、“瀑布屏”等异形屏的出现,彻底改变了状态栏区域的形态。状态栏不再是一个简单的、规则高度的矩形区域。它需要避开摄像头、传感器等硬件开孔。这就引入了“安全区域”的概念。安全区域是指屏幕上保证内容可以安全显示而不被遮挡的矩形区域。状态栏的实际可用高度,变成了从屏幕顶部到安全区域顶部的距离。对于开发者,现代界面开发框架都提供了相应的工具来应对,例如在iOS中使用安全区域布局边距,在安卓中使用视图系统窗口嵌入功能,在跨平台框架如弗拉特或反应原生中也有对应的安全区域组件。 动态状态栏:内容与颜色的变化 现代移动系统的状态栏并非静态。它可以根据当前显示的应用程序内容动态调整其图标的颜色。例如,在安卓系统中,状态栏图标颜色可以在浅色和深色主题之间切换,以确保在不同背景色上的可见性。在iOS中,应用程序可以设置状态栏的风格为深色内容或浅色内容。更进一步的,有些应用(如视频播放器、游戏)会采用全屏模式,完全隐藏状态栏以获得完全沉浸的体验。这些动态行为意味着状态栏的高度“占用”虽然固定,但其视觉表现和对应用内容的影响是灵活可变的,应用设计需要充分考虑这些场景。 在用户界面设计与开发中的实践应用 对于用户界面设计师,在制作高保真设计稿时,必须依据目标平台和设备的最新设计规范,正确设置画布的安全区域和状态栏高度。直接使用平台提供的设计模板是最佳实践。对于前端和移动端开发者,关键在于编写能够自动适配不同状态栏高度的代码。这通常意味着:避免将任何固定边距值写死在代码中;使用系统提供的应用程序编程接口或框架组件来获取当前的状态栏高度;并确保所有从屏幕顶部开始的布局,其起始位置都基于“状态栏高度 + 应用自定义导航栏高度”来计算,从而实现界面元素的精确定位。 跨平台开发框架中的状态栏处理 在使用如反应原生、弗拉特、优尼应用等跨平台框架进行开发时,处理状态栏高度有一套统一的逻辑。这些框架通常会提供抽象化的应用程序编程接口或组件,来屏蔽底层iOS和安卓的差异。例如,在反应原生中,可以通过“安全区域视图”组件自动处理刘海屏和安全区域;在弗拉特中,可以使用“媒体查询”获取屏幕顶部边距,或使用“安全区域”小部件。框架的目标是让开发者用一套代码,就能在多个平台上实现正确的状态栏适配,但深入了解各原生平台的原理,有助于排查和解决更复杂的适配问题。 测试与验证:确保多设备兼容性 由于状态栏高度的多样性,严格的测试是确保应用质量不可或缺的环节。测试工作需要在多种真实设备上进行,尤其要覆盖具有特殊屏幕形态的设备,如不同尺寸的刘海屏、挖孔屏、折叠屏等。测试时,需要重点关注:状态栏是否遮挡了应用的标题或关键按钮;状态栏图标颜色是否与应用背景色冲突导致看不清;应用在全屏模式与非全屏模式切换时,界面布局是否平滑过渡;在折叠屏设备展开和折叠过程中,状态栏区域的变化是否导致界面错乱。利用云测试平台和自动化测试脚本,可以大大提高这类兼容性测试的效率和覆盖率。 历史视角:状态栏高度的演变趋势 回顾移动设备发展史,状态栏的高度总体呈现出一种“先增后减”的微妙趋势。在功能机时代和智能手机早期,屏幕尺寸小,状态栏区域非常有限。随着屏幕增大,状态栏有了更多空间展示信息。而进入全面屏时代后,为了追求极致的屏占比,状态栏的物理高度被尽可能压缩,甚至通过异形屏设计将其“融入”屏幕边缘。未来的趋势可能是状态栏的进一步“隐形化”或“动态化”,例如利用屏下摄像头技术彻底消除开孔,或者状态栏信息只在用户需要查看时才被唤醒显示,从而在提供信息的同时,最大程度地释放屏幕的显示空间。 常见错误与最佳实践总结 在处理状态栏高度时,常见的错误包括:假设所有设备的高度都相同而使用固定值;忽略了安全区域,导致内容被刘海或摄像头遮挡;未考虑状态栏颜色与背景色的对比度。遵循的最佳实践应是:始终从权威的设计规范获取基准值;在代码中动态获取尺寸;使用安全区域布局作为界面开发的基准线;为不同的设备类型和屏幕形态设计针对性的适配方案;并进行充分的跨设备测试。将状态栏视为一个动态的、需要被尊重的系统空间,而非一个可以随意覆盖的固定区域,是设计出优秀应用界面的重要前提。 对用户体验的深远影响 最终,状态栏高度的所有技术细节和设计规范,都服务于一个核心目标:提升用户体验。一个适配良好的状态栏,能让用户无感地获取系统信息,顺畅地与应用交互。它不会遮挡内容,不会引起误触,也不会因为颜色冲突而难以辨认。反之,一个处理不当的状态栏,会带来持续的干扰感,破坏应用的沉浸感和专业度。因此,无论是产品经理、设计师还是开发者,都应当给予这个“小细节”以足够的重视。理解并掌握状态栏高度的奥秘,是构建高质量数字产品用户体验的基石之一。 综上所述,“状态栏高度多少”这个问题,背后牵连着操作系统规范、硬件设备差异、交互设计原则和软件开发实践等一系列知识。它没有一个简单的、放之四海而皆准的答案,而是需要我们在特定的平台、特定的设备、特定的场景下去寻找最优解。希望本文的详尽探讨,能为您在用户界面设计与开发的道路上,提供一份有价值的参考地图,助您打造出体验更出色、适配更完美的应用程序。
相关文章
电流钳作为一种关键的电气测量工具,其性能精度直接关系到电气系统诊断与数据采集的可靠性。本文将系统性地阐述电流钳检验的全流程,涵盖从基础外观与功能性检查,到核心的精度、带宽、相位以及安全规范等关键性能指标的验证方法。文章旨在为用户提供一套详尽、可操作的检验指南,确保测量数据的准确性与设备使用的安全性。
2026-03-12 04:23:39
118人看过
在现代音视频系统中,av切换器(音频视频切换器)是一种至关重要的设备,它能够将来自多个信号源的音频和视频信号,智能地切换并输出到一个或多个显示及播放终端。这种设备的核心价值在于简化布线、集中管理并提升多信号源场景下的操作效率,广泛应用于家庭影院、教育演示、会议系统及专业监控等多个领域,是现代视听集成解决方案中不可或缺的一环。
2026-03-12 04:23:32
148人看过
本文深入探讨了电子(Electron)应用程序的测试策略与实践。内容涵盖从基础的单元测试与集成测试,到针对跨平台特性的端到端测试,并详细介绍了主进程、渲染进程以及两者间通信的测试方法。文章还涉及图形用户界面自动化、持续集成流程的搭建,以及性能、安全与可访问性等专项测试,旨在为开发者提供一套完整、可操作的电子应用质量保障体系。
2026-03-12 04:23:28
174人看过
功率因素,是衡量电气设备电能利用效率的关键指标,其计算涉及有功功率、视在功率及相位差等核心概念。本文将从定义出发,系统阐述功率因素的理论计算方法、测量技术手段、低功率因素的成因及其危害,并深入探讨改善措施与经济效益分析,旨在为电力系统设计、运行维护及节能管理提供一份详尽的实用指南。
2026-03-12 04:22:31
335人看过
当用户搜索“oppo账号密码多少”时,其背后隐藏着对账号体系安全、密码管理以及问题解决方案的深度需求。本文将从账号本质出发,系统阐述OPPO账号不存在统一密码的原因,详细解析密码设置原则、找回与重置全流程,并深入探讨保障账号安全的十二项核心实践。内容涵盖官方服务工具使用、常见误区辨析以及高级安全策略,旨在为用户提供一份权威、详尽且具备高度可操作性的安全指南。
2026-03-12 04:22:29
76人看过
余额宝作为大众熟知的货币基金理财产品,其额度问题关乎用户资金规划与收益。本文将深度解析余额宝的转入额度、持有额度及快速转出额度限制,阐明其与基金规模、监管政策及市场环境的关联,并对比同类产品,提供实用应对策略,助您高效管理闲置资金。
2026-03-12 04:22:14
109人看过
热门推荐
资讯中心:
.webp)
.webp)

.webp)
.webp)